a 2,000 pound car is driving at 60 miles/hour along a straight, level road. what is the net force acting on the car?

Respuesta :

MathPhys
MathPhys MathPhys
  • 03-02-2020

Answer:

0

Explanation:

According to Newton's second law, the net force is equal to the mass times the acceleration.  Since the car is not accelerating, the net force is 0.
